Self-programming

In modern vehicles, the keyfob contains a chip that communicates with your car. Both devices must be programmed in order that they can recognize one and communicate with each. The process is not easy and requires special tools that are normally only available to locksmiths or dealers. If you follow the proper instructions, you can program your key fob by yourself at home.

First, ensure that you have the correct VIN for your vehicle. This can be found on a variety of official documents, such as the title or registration as well as the insurance card. The VIN is also printed on the majority of windshields for vehicles. By using this information, you will be able to find the programming code for your specific car.

The next step is to remove the ignition key. Insert the new key in the ignition and turn the key to "On". There will be a click as you enter the programming a key mode. This will let you test the key and determine whether it's working.

The key may need to reset if it isn't working. Slide the purple locking clip off and take it off. Then, with the help of a small tool, lift the tab that locks pins and pull the wire between pins 3 and 15. Now you can replace the key for your vehicle.

It's crucial to act quickly after resetting the car key. You have only just a few seconds to get the car out of programming mode before it resets. If you are waiting too long and the keys aren't properly reprogrammed and you'll be forced to restart the process.

If you aren't able to complete this task yourself, you can ask a locksmith or dealer to help you. They will have all the necessary equipment and can program your keys in just some minutes. Some cars require a more sophisticated device known as"dealer key programmer. "dealer key programmer." These are bidirectional OBD-II devices which connect to the vehicle's computer via the OBD2 port. Unlike standard key programmers, they are only available to dealers and require an authorized license from a professional to operate.

Key programmer

A key programmer can be used to program keys on most automobiles. The device is plugged into the vehicle's OBD II port. When the device is activated, it will show various indicators such as yellow and green LEDs blinking synchronously (the exact sequence is dependent on the model of your car). The key is ready to use after the programming has been completed. The device can be used to activate an existing key.

You can get a key programmer from a locksmith or from an online retailer. You should be aware, however, that this method may not work and may cause damage to your vehicle if it is not performed correctly. It could also be illegal in some states. It is recommended to visit an authorized locksmith to program keys.

The locksmith must know the model, make and year of the car in order to program the key. This allows them to choose the appropriate blank key fobs and tools. The locksmith will then clone the transponder chip or program the key using specialized equipment. They will then test the new key to make sure it works as intended. If there are problems they will re-programme until everything works exactly as it should.

Certain vehicles require sophisticated tools for key programming that are not available to the general public. These tools, which are typically utilized by locksmiths or mechanics are expensive and can cost thousands of dollars. Some basic key programming devices are simple to use and cost-effective. The NCT-I Pro is a good choice, and it works with the majority of SMART models.

You can also buy a key programming car keys near me kit that contains all the components you need to program a new car key. The kit usually includes a key fob and an EEPROM tool, and an instruction manual. The EEPROM tool is used to extract security information from the EEPROM inside the key and immobilizer modules. The key fob is then able to communicate with the vehicle’s electronics to start the engine or unlock the doors.

Keyless entry

A keyless entry system has numerous advantages for vehicles. It can make the vehicle more secure, decrease maintenance costs, and increase convenience. It also helps businesses manage their fleet of vehicles more efficiently. These advantages can only be realized only if the key fob been programmed correctly. This process can be complicated and time-consuming, but it is essential for the safety of the driver and passengers. It is recommended to employ a professional key programmer in Jurupa Valley with the experience and equipment to complete this task.

Car key fobs are fitted with a transponder key programmer which emits a radio frequency that carries the vehicle's digital identity code. The code is transmitted from the key programing fob, and then recognized by the vehicle's radio as the correct key. A keyless entry system is used to lock and unlock a car. It can also allow remote start, among other options.

Remote keyless entry systems, unlike traditional keys, are designed to make it more difficult to steal and pick. They transmit a unique signal to identify the key to a PASE module. The module then reads the information, and unlocks the door. However this technology isn't 100% secure, and thieves are able to manipulate the signal and manipulate the PASE module into recognizing the incorrect ID.

While it is possible to reprogram the car key fob on your own, many are advised to get it done professionally by a locksmith or dealer. This will stop other people from making a mistake and using it for theft. Additionally, it will ensure that the new key functions correctly with your vehicle.

The first step in reprogramming your key fob is to sit in the driver's chair with the key fob and ignition key in. Turn the ignition key to "On" but don't start your vehicle. Set it to this position for a certain amount of time, usually about 10 minutes. Press any button on your key fob within a specific time period. The vehicle will respond either by resetting the door lock or emitting an audible chime, based on the model.
